博客 AI辅助数据开发:高效实现与技术要点解析

AI辅助数据开发:高效实现与技术要点解析

   数栈君   发表于 2025-10-20 15:02  86  0

在数字化转型的浪潮中,数据开发已成为企业提升竞争力的核心驱动力。然而,传统数据开发过程复杂、耗时长,且对技术要求较高,难以满足企业对高效、智能数据处理的需求。近年来,人工智能(AI)技术的快速发展为企业提供了新的解决方案——AI辅助数据开发。本文将深入解析AI辅助数据开发的核心概念、技术要点及实现方法,帮助企业更好地利用AI技术提升数据开发效率。


一、AI辅助数据开发的概念与意义

AI辅助数据开发是指通过人工智能技术,自动化或半自动化地完成数据开发过程中的关键任务,如数据清洗、特征工程、模型训练和部署等。与传统数据开发相比,AI辅助数据开发具有以下显著优势:

  1. 提升效率:AI能够快速处理大量数据,减少人工操作的时间和精力。
  2. 降低门槛:通过自动化工具,非专业人员也能完成复杂的数据开发任务。
  3. 增强准确性:AI算法能够发现数据中的隐藏模式,减少人为错误。
  4. 支持实时决策:AI辅助的数据开发能够实时反馈数据变化,为企业提供及时的决策支持。

对于数据中台、数字孪生和数字可视化等领域,AI辅助数据开发能够显著提升数据处理的效率和质量,为企业构建智能化的数据生态系统提供强有力的支持。


二、AI辅助数据开发的技术要点

AI辅助数据开发涉及多个技术领域,以下是实现其高效应用的关键技术要点:

1. 数据预处理与清洗

数据预处理是数据开发的基础环节,AI技术能够帮助自动完成以下任务:

  • 自动识别异常值:通过机器学习算法检测数据中的异常值,并提供修复建议。
  • 数据补齐:利用插值法或预测模型填补缺失值。
  • 数据标准化/归一化:自动调整数据范围,使其适合不同算法的要求。
  • 数据格式转换:支持多种数据格式的自动转换,如结构化数据与非结构化数据之间的转换。

2. 特征工程

特征工程是数据开发中的关键步骤,直接影响模型的性能。AI辅助数据开发可以通过以下方式优化特征工程:

  • 自动特征提取:利用自然语言处理(NLP)和计算机视觉(CV)技术从文本、图像等非结构化数据中提取特征。
  • 特征选择与优化:通过遗传算法或梯度提升树(如LightGBM)自动选择最优特征组合。
  • 特征生成:基于现有数据生成新的特征,例如时间序列特征或统计特征。

3. 模型训练与部署

AI辅助数据开发能够简化模型训练和部署过程:

  • 自动化模型选择:根据数据特征和业务需求,自动推荐适合的机器学习模型。
  • 超参数优化:通过网格搜索或贝叶斯优化自动调整模型参数,提升模型性能。
  • 模型部署与监控:提供一键式部署功能,并实时监控模型性能,及时发现并修复问题。

4. 数据可视化与洞察

数据可视化是数据开发的重要环节,AI技术能够帮助用户更直观地理解和分析数据:

  • 自动生成可视化图表:根据数据特征自动推荐合适的可视化方式,如柱状图、折线图、热力图等。
  • 动态数据更新:支持实时数据更新,并自动生成最新的可视化结果。
  • 智能数据洞察:通过AI算法发现数据中的隐藏趋势,并提供数据驱动的决策建议。

三、AI辅助数据开发的实现方法

要实现高效的AI辅助数据开发,企业需要从以下几个方面入手:

1. 数据准备与整合

  • 数据源多样化:支持从多种数据源(如数据库、文件、API等)获取数据。
  • 数据清洗与融合:通过自动化工具完成数据清洗和融合,确保数据质量。
  • 数据存储与管理:采用分布式存储和管理技术,提升数据访问效率。

2. 数据开发工具的选择

  • 选择合适的AI工具:根据企业需求选择适合的AI辅助数据开发工具,如Google AI Platform、AWS SageMaker等。
  • 集成开发环境(IDE):使用支持AI功能的IDE,如Jupyter Notebook、VS Code等,提升开发效率。
  • 自动化工作流:利用自动化工作流工具(如Airflow、Azkaban)实现数据开发的自动化。

3. 模型开发与部署

  • 模型训练与验证:通过分布式计算框架(如Spark、Hadoop)加速模型训练,并通过交叉验证确保模型的泛化能力。
  • 模型部署与监控:将训练好的模型部署到生产环境,并通过监控工具实时跟踪模型性能。

4. 数据安全与隐私保护

  • 数据加密:对敏感数据进行加密处理,确保数据安全。
  • 访问控制:通过权限管理工具控制数据访问权限,防止数据泄露。
  • 合规性检查:确保数据处理过程符合相关法律法规(如GDPR、CCPA)。

四、AI辅助数据开发的应用场景

1. 数据中台

在数据中台建设中,AI辅助数据开发能够帮助企业快速构建统一的数据平台,实现数据的高效管理和应用。例如:

  • 数据清洗与整合:通过AI技术自动清洗和整合来自不同部门的数据,构建统一的数据仓库。
  • 特征工程与建模:利用AI工具快速完成特征工程和模型训练,支持业务部门的实时数据分析需求。

2. 数字孪生

数字孪生技术需要实时处理大量数据,AI辅助数据开发能够显著提升其性能:

  • 实时数据处理:通过AI技术快速处理来自传感器和物联网设备的实时数据,支持数字孪生的实时更新。
  • 预测与优化:利用AI模型预测设备运行状态,并优化生产流程,降低运营成本。

3. 数字可视化

在数字可视化领域,AI辅助数据开发能够帮助用户更直观地理解和分析数据:

  • 智能图表推荐:根据数据特征自动推荐合适的可视化方式,提升数据洞察的效率。
  • 动态数据更新:支持实时数据更新,并自动生成最新的可视化结果,为企业提供实时数据支持。

五、AI辅助数据开发的未来趋势

随着AI技术的不断发展,AI辅助数据开发将呈现以下趋势:

  1. 自动化数据处理:未来的数据开发将更加自动化,AI工具能够完成从数据清洗到模型部署的全流程。
  2. 实时反馈机制:AI辅助数据开发将支持实时数据处理和反馈,帮助企业更快地响应市场变化。
  3. 多模态数据融合:AI技术将支持多种数据类型的融合分析,如文本、图像、视频等,提升数据开发的综合能力。

六、申请试用 & https://www.dtstack.com/?src=bbs

如果您对AI辅助数据开发感兴趣,可以申请试用相关工具,体验其带来的高效与便捷。通过实践,您将更好地理解AI技术如何助力数据开发,为企业创造更大的价值。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料